Project: day 130: get crafty/ the meaning of Easter/ a simple craft and dessert in one to teach the story of Easter through colored jelly beans!
Difficulty rating (1=easiest, 5= way too hard!): 1
• Would I do it again? yes. It is so easy to get sidetracked from the real meaning and story of why we celebrate Easter, but doing this craft/activity helps keep things in focus!
• What I would do differently: do it every year as an Easter family tradition, as well as have printable versions of the poem to hand out to relatives and friends :)
• Items used: jelly beans, ice cream cones, twizzlers or licorice, as well as the cute idea and poem behind the meaning of each colors go to: http://beinglds.blogspot.com/2011/03/telling-story-of-easter-with-jelly.html and poem here: http://www.dltk-holidays.com/easter/jellybean.htm
